Each one station should be connected shortly to ground, and at least separately. Each one wire can be broken incidentally and when you have like train cars connection to ground, you will receive all stations after disconnected. But if you use parallel grounding, only one station can produce damages for your products. It is the most important rule with making grounding. Second point of view is that for grounding it is not the most important resistance value, but impedance must be less than 1 ohm. Impedance is built not only from resistance but additionally with capacitance and inductance of the wire. Longer wire or smaller diameter of copper means higher impedance, and consider all bonding points (independent if screwed or soldered enough).
